All Courses
×
iHUB IIT R

Data Engineering Course

6,877 Ratings

  • Data Engineering course in association with iHUB IIT Roorkee
  • Gain expertise in Data Engineering skills like Python, SQL, & more
  • Placement Assistance upon course completion
  • Learn from IIT Faculty & Industry Experts

In collaboration with

Microsoft logo
Apply Now Download Brochure

Learning Format

Online Bootcamp

Live Classes

7 Months

Career Services

by Intellipaat

iHUB IIT Roorkee

Certification

EMI Starts

at ₹8,000/month*

trustpilot 3109
sitejabber 1493
mouthshut 24542

Data Engineering Course Overview

Our Data Engineering course will provide you with in-depth knowledge in SQL, Python, data pipelines, data transformation, Spark, and cloud services of AWS and Azure. Multiple Data Engineering courses and real-world projects help you master core concepts & skills like creating production-ready ETL and pulling data from multiple data sources, building cloud data warehouses, Data Modelling, etc.

Key Highlights

7 Months of Live Sessions by Industry Experts & IIT Faculty
200 Hrs of Self-paced Videos
One-on-One with Industry Mentors
24*7 Support
50+ Industry Projects & Case Studies
iHUB IIT Roorkee Certification
2 days Campus Immersion at IIT Roorkee
Lifetime Free Upgrade
Soft Skills Essential Training
Dedicated Learning Management Team

About iHUB DivyaSampark, IIT Roorkee

iHUB DivyaSampark at IIT Roorkee, established under the National Mission on Interdisciplinary Cyber-Physical Systems (NM-ICPS) by the Department of Science and Technology (DST), focuses on fostering innovation in advanced technologies such as AI, ML, and more. The hub plays a pivotal role in technology development, incubation, and startups, particularly in areas like Healthcare,Read More..

Upon the completion of this program, you will:

  • Receive a certificate from iHUB DivyaSampark, IIT Roorkee

Benefits for students from Microsoft:

  • Industry-recognized certification from Microsoft
  • Real-time projects and exercises
Data Engineering Course iHUB IIT Roorkee Certificate Image Click to Zoom

Career Transition

57% Average Salary Hike

45 LPA Highest Salary

12000+ Career Transitions

300+ Hiring Partners

Career Transition Handbook

*Past record is no guarantee of future job prospects

Who Can Apply for the Data Engineering Course?

  • Freshers and Undergraduates willing to pursue a career in data engineering
  • Anyone looking for a career transition to data engineering
  • IT professionals
  • Experienced professionals willing to learn data engineering
  • Technical and non-technical professionals with basic-level programming knowledge can also apply
  • Project Managers
who can apply

What Roles Does a Data Engineer Play?

Big Data Engineer

They design and build complex data pipelines and have expert knowledge in coding using Python, etc. These professionals collaborate and work closely with data scientists to run the code using various tools such as the Hadoop ecosystem, etc.

Data Architect

They are typically the database administrators and are responsible for data management. These professionals have in-depth knowledge of databases, and they also help in business operations.

Business Intelligence Engineer

They are skilled in data warehousing and create dimension models for loading data for large-scale enterprise reporting solutions. These professionals are experts in using ELT tools and SQL.

Data Warehouse Engineer

They are responsible for looking after the ETL processes, performance administration, dimensional design, etc. These professionals take care of the full back-end development and dimensional design of the table structure.

Technical Architect

They design and define the overall structure of a system to improve the business of an organization. The job role of these professionals involves breaking large projects into manageable pieces.

View More

15+ Skills to Master

SQL

Data Warehousing

OLAP

OLTP

ETL

Python Programming

Spark

Spark Streaming

AWS

EMR

Apache Airflow

S3

S3 Glacier

Docker

Kubernetes

View More

3+ Tools to Master

informatica 1 AWS 1 SparkSQL

Data Engineer Course Syllabus

Live Course Self Paced
  • Introduction to SQL
  • Database Normalization and Entity Relationship Model
  • SQL Operators
  • Join, Tables, and Variables in SQL
  • Deep Dive into SQL Functions
  • Subqueries in SQL
  • SQL Views, Functions, and Stored Procedures
  • User-defined Functions in SQL
  • SQL Optimization and Performance
  • SQL Parsing
  • Managing Database Concurrency
Download Brochure
  • Python Basics
  • OOPs Concept
  • NumPy
  • Pandas
  • Data Visualization
  • File Handling
  • Exception Handling
  • Regular Expressions Fundamentals
Download Brochure
  • Introduction to Linux
  • File System Navigation
  • File and Text Manipulation
  • User and Group Management
  • Process Management
  • System Configuration and Networking
  • System Monitoring and Logging
  • Shell Scripting
  • Security and Permissions
  • Advanced Linux Commands
Download Brochure
  • Basic Concepts of Data Modelling
  • Business Data Requirements – Entities and Classes
  • Business Data Requirements – Attributes
  • How To Link Things Together – Relationships
  • Requirements Analysis
  • Conceptual Data Modelling
  • Logical Data Modelling
  • Physical Data Modelling
  • Data Modelling Tools and Techniques
  • Data Modelling Documentation and Communication
Download Brochure
  • AWS Basics
  • Amazon Kinesis
  • Amazon MSK (Managed Streaming for Apache Kafka)
  • AWS Glue
  • Amazon EMR (Elastic MapReduce)
  • Amazon S3 (Simple Storage Service)
  • Amazon S3 Glacier
  • DynamoDB
  • AWS Redshift
  • Amazon Athena
  • Amazon QuickSight
Download Brochure
  • Introduction to Microsoft Azure
  • Authentication, Authorization, and Monitoring
  • Data Storage and Integration
  • Azure Synapse Analytics and Databricks
  • Azure Stream Analytics, and Azure Service Bus
Download Brochure
  • Introduction to Airflow
    • Introduction to Airflow
    • Testing a Task in Airflow
    • Examining Airflow Commands
    • Airflow DAGs
    • Defining a Simple DAG
    • Working With DAGs and the Airflow Shell
    • Troubleshooting DAG Creation
    • Airflow Web Interface
    • Starting the Airflow Webserver
    • Navigating the Airflow UI
    • Examining DAGs With the Airflow UI
  • Airflow Operators
    • Defining a BashOperator Task
    • Multiple BashOperator
    • Airflow Tasks
    • Define Order of BashOperator
    • Determining the Order of Tasks
    • Troubleshooting DAG Dependencies
    • Additional Operators
    • Using the PythonOperator
    • More PythonOperator
    • EmailOperator and Dependencies
    • Airflow Scheduling
    • Schedule a DAG via Python
    • Deciphering Airflow Schedules
    • Troubleshooting DAG Runs
Download Brochure
  • Introduction to Apache Spark
  • PySpark SQL and Data Frames
  • Apache Kafka and Flume
  • PySpark Streaming
  • Introduction to PySpark Machine Learning
Download Brochure

Elective Courses

  • Introduction to DevOps
  • Git
  • Docker
  • Kubernetes
  • Jenkins
Download Brochure
  • Introduction to Power BI
  • Data Extraction
  • Data Transformation – Shaping & Combining Data
  • Data Modeling & DAX (Data Analysis Expressions)
  • Data Visualization with Analytics
  • Power BI Service (Cloud), Q & A, and Data Insights
  • Power BI Settings, Administration & Direct Connectivity
  • Embedded Power BI with API & Power BI Mobile
  • Power BI Advance & Power BI Premium
Download Brochure
View More
Disclaimer
Intellipaat reserves the right to modify, amend or change the structure of module & the curriculum, after due consensus with the university/certification partner.

Program Highlights

Live Session across 7 months
Learn from Industry SME’s & IIT Faculty
50+ Industry Projects & Case Studies
24*7 Support

Data Engineering Projects

Projects in data engineering will be a part of your certification to consolidate your learning and ensure that you have real-world industry experience.

Reviews

(5)

Career Services By Intellipaat

Career Services
guaranteed
3 Guaranteed Interviews
job portal
Access to Intellipaat Job Portal
Mock Interview Preparation
1 on 1 Career Mentoring Sessions
resume 1
Career Oriented Sessions
linkedin 1
Resume & LinkedIn Profile Building
View More

Our Alumni Works At

Hiring Partners

Data Engineering Course Admission Details

The application process consists of three simple steps. An offer of admission will be made to selected candidates based on the feedback from the interview panel. The selected candidates will be notified over email and phone, and they can block their seats through the payment of the admission fee.

ad submit

Submit Application

Tell us a bit about yourself and why you want to join this program

ad review

Application Review

An admission panel will shortlist candidates based on their application

ad admission 1

Admission

Selected candidates will be notified within 3 days

Program Fee

Total Admission Fee

₹ 1,59,030

Apply Now

EMI Starts at

₹ 8,000

We partnered with financing companies to provide very competitive finance options at 0% interest rate

Financing Partners

dk-fee-emi-logo

The credit facility is provided by a third-party financing company and any arrangement with such financing companies is outside.

Upcoming Application Deadline 26th July 2025

Admissions close once the required number of students is enrolled for the upcoming cohort. Apply early to secure your seat.

Program Cohorts

Next Cohorts

Date Time Batch Type
Program Induction 26th July 2025 08:00 PM - 11:00 PM IST Weekend (Sat-Sun)
Regular Classes 26th July 2025 08:00 PM - 11:00 PM IST Weekend (Sat-Sun)
Apply Now

Data Engineering Training FAQs

What is Data Engineering?

Data engineering can be called a branch of data science that involves preparing the data to be analysed by data scientists and data analysts. This online data engineer course training course includes practically applying data collection techniques and maintaining the organization’s data pipeline systems.

This online Data Engineering course will validate your skills in the domain and will add value to your resume. The real-life practical applications will help you develop a strong skill set that you can showcase to recruiters. Get the best Data Engineer course certification and excel in your data engineering career.

Candidates are required to complete the assignments, Quizzes, case studies and project work as part of the program to be eligible for the certification.

According to Glassdoor, the average annual salary of a certified data engineer in India is ₹850,000.

It is recommended that you have a basic level of knowledge in programming or any object-oriented coding language to better understand the Data Engineering concepts.

The top companies hiring data engineers around the globe are as follows:

  • Tata Consultancy Services (TCS)
  • LTI
  • Accenture
  • Amazon
  • Infosys
  • Capgemini

Yes, you can join our data engineering course even if you do not have technical experience or are not from a technical background. However, knowing any programming language will be helpful.

You are expected to devote six to seven hours per week throughout the duration of the program to master the data engineering concepts taught in the online classes.

You can expect a salary range of Rs.7-8 lakhs from the job offer. However, salary package depends on multiple factors like experience, location, company type, etc. We have seen our learners achieving up to 30 to 60 LPA in salary packages as well.

Yes, Intellipaat certification is highly recognized in the industry. Our alumni work in more than 10,000 corporations and startups, which is a testament that our programs are industry-aligned and well-recognized. Additionally, the Intellipaat program is in partnership with the National Skill Development Corporation (NSDC), which further validates its credibility. Learners will get an NSDC certificate along with Intellipaat certificate for the programs they enrol in.

View More

What is included in this course?

  • Non-biased career guidance
  • Counselling based on your skills and preference
  • No repetitive calls, only as per convenience
  • Rigorous curriculum designed by industry experts
  • Complete this program while you work